Materials and Methods 2.2 Uniaxial Tension For this section of the laboratory experiment, a metal (Cu, 99.3%) and three metal alloys (α-brass [64.5% Cu, 35% Zn, 1% Pb], aluminum 6061, and steel 1045) were subjected to uniaxial tension using the Instron Model 4505.   2 F. HEYMSETAL. Figure 1 The strip ironing device. to as the draw bar, is visible in Figure 1 and plays the role of the punch or ram in the actual ironing operation. Once locked in position at a set reduction the wedged shape die is moved down over the surface of the strip which is therefore elongated and moves relatives to the fixed drawbar. The lap-shear test is illustrated in Fig. 3.13. It was originally made from two pieces of 1.6 mm metal strip one inch in width, bonded together over a length of half an inch.   A hot workability testing apparatus has been designed and constructed for determining flow stress and fracture of materials at elevated temperatures. The system is composed of four major elements: a closed-loop servo-controlled hydraulic testing machine with programmable and custom-made control components; a high temperature tooling and radiant heating furnace for isothermal test
